Oracle always free vps benchmark

Benchmark started on 18-Sep-2019 22:07:34 | |
## System Information | |
OS Name : Ubuntu 18.04.3 LTS (64 bit) | |
Kernel : KVM / 4.15.0-1025-oracle | |
Hostname : spark | |
CPU Model : AMD EPYC 7551 32-Core Processor | |
CPU Cores : 2 cores @ 1996.245 MHz | |
CPU Cache : 512 KB | |
Total RAM : 982 MiB (Free 571 MiB) | |
Total SWAP : SWAP not enabled | |
Total Space : 91GB (6% used) | |
Running for : 5hrs 45min 11sec | |
## CDN Speedtest | |
CacheFly : 6.16 MiB/s | 49.25 Mbps | ping 5.762ms | |
Gdrive : 5.76 MiB/s | 46.11 Mbps | ping 0.827ms | |
## North America Speedtest | |
Softlayer, Washington, USA : 2.38 MiB/s | 19.02 Mbps | ping 109.536ms | |
SoftLayer, San Jose, USA : 816.78 KiB/s | 6.38 Mbps | ping 164.526ms | |
SoftLayer, Dallas, USA : 1.37 MiB/s | 10.93 Mbps | ping 136.600ms | |
Vultr, New Jersey, USA : 5.09 MiB/s | 40.72 Mbps | ping 97.419ms | |
Vultr, Seattle, USA : 4.66 MiB/s | 37.28 Mbps | ping 151.727ms | |
Vultr, Dallas, USA : 4.96 MiB/s | 39.65 Mbps | ping 132.584ms | |
Vultr, Los Angeles, USA : 3.45 MiB/s | 27.63 Mbps | ping 164.634ms | |
Ramnode, New York, USA : 3.42 MiB/s | 27.32 Mbps | ping 104.070ms | |
Ramnode, Atlanta, USA : 3.00 MiB/s | 23.98 Mbps | ping 108.508ms | |
OVH, Beauharnois, Canada : 2.33 MiB/s | 18.66 Mbps | ping 123.894ms | |
## Europe Speedtest | |
Vultr, London, UK : 5.90 MiB/s | 47.17 Mbps | ping 19.537ms | |
LeaseWeb, Frankfurt, Germany : 5.73 MiB/s | 45.85 Mbps | ping 5.855ms | |
Hetzner, Germany : 5.45 MiB/s | 43.62 Mbps | ping 9.022ms | |
Ramnode, Alblasserdam, NL : 5.55 MiB/s | 44.41 Mbps | ping 36.288ms | |
Vultr, Amsterdam, NL : 5.88 MiB/s | 47.00 Mbps | ping 34.706ms | |
EDIS, Stockholm, Sweden : 2.01 KiB/s | 0.02 Mbps | ping 30.200ms | |
OVH, Roubaix, France : 5.91 MiB/s | 47.24 Mbps | ping 33.530ms | |
Online, France : 5.71 MiB/s | 45.66 Mbps | ping 13.627ms | |
Prometeus, Milan, Italy : 5.60 MiB/s | 44.81 Mbps | ping 4.364ms | |
## Exotic Speedtest | |
Sydney, Australia : 1.28 MiB/s | 10.25 Mbps | ping 303.977ms | |
Lagoon, New Caledonia : 867.68 KiB/s | 6.78 Mbps | ping 359.290ms | |
Hosteasy, Moldova : 5.77 MiB/s | 46.14 Mbps | ping 41.190ms | |
Prima, Argentina : 258.77 KiB/s | 2.02 Mbps | ping error! | |
## Asia Speedtest | |
SoftLayer, Singapore : 677.46 KiB/s | 5.29 Mbps | ping 194.233ms | |
Linode, Tokyo, Japan : 1.43 MiB/s | 11.42 Mbps | ping 276.302ms | |
Linode, Singapore : 2.15 MiB/s | 17.23 Mbps | ping 253.074ms | |
Vultr, Tokyo, Japan : 2.85 MiB/s | 22.82 Mbps | ping 251.315ms | |
## IO Test | |
CPU Speed: | |
bzip2 512MB - 26.4 MB/s | |
sha256 512MB - 49.7 MB/s | |
md5sum 512MB - 101 MB/s | |
Disk Speed (512MB): | |
I/O Speed - 63.1 MB/s | |
I/O Direct - 49.1 MB/s | |
RAM Speed (491MB): | |
Avg. write - 1126.4 MB/s | |
Avg. read - 3072.0 MB/s | |
Benchmark finished in 202 seconds | |
